What does a river do to the land it flows through?

Respuesta :

rareshopking96 rareshopking96
  • 09-03-2021
Rivers and streams erode the land as they move from higher elevations to the sea. Eroded materials can be carried in a river as dissolved load, suspended load, or bed load. A river will deeply erode the land when it is far from its base level, the elevation where it enters standing water like the ocean.
